Brick wall reinforcing method and structure
The invention relates to a brick wall reinforcing method and structure. The brick wall reinforcing structure comprises a foundation, a first steel column, a second steel column, a first steel plate, asecond steel plate, reinforcing steel bars and a third steel column. A first embedded part and a second embedded part are arranged on the foundation, and the arrangement direction of the first embedded part is horizontally perpendicular to that of the second embedded part. The first steel column is arranged on the first embedded part, the second steel column is arranged on the second embedded part, and the first steel column and the second steel column are arranged side by side in parallel. A first sliding block is arranged on the first steel plate and is in sliding connection with the firststeel column, the second steel column and the third steel column. A second sliding block is arranged on the second steel plate and is in sliding connection with the first steel column. The reinforcingsteel bars are arranged on the foundation and located between bricks. The brick wall reinforcing method comprises the steps of size calculation, foundation and embedded part construction, reinforcingdevice installation, building wall body installation and steel plate reinforcing. By means of the brick wall reinforcing method and structure, the bearing capacity of wall faces can be improved, connection between the wall faces is more stable, and the brick wall reinforcing structure is good in shockproof capacity, reinforces a brick wall simply and is easy to operate.
